40-50mm is way too much if you drive in Adelaide - that is about how much I am lowered and I hate it - I am going to raise mine up again as my aftermarket front bar and exhaust components both scrape on everything. If your car is stock you might be ok though. Also keep in mind that if you drop it that much you will definitely need rear camber arms, as there is not much camber adjustment in the rear of the V35s. Replacing Disc Rotors
Nightcrawler replied to reverseworm's topic in V Series (V35, V36, V37 & Infiniti)
It is a piece of cake. A few tips: - if you brake fluid is very full in the reservoir, remove some, as when you squeeze open the brake pads to put on the new/wider disks, fluid gets forced back into the reservior and will overflow if it is too full (I did this when I recently changed pads). - open the brake bleed nipples to make squeezing the pads open easier, but once disks are fitted you should bleed them again anyway. - buy braided brake lines (cheap = $200-$300) and put them on while you have it all apart. -

How Often Do You Guys Scrape?
Nightcrawler replied to Marshan's topic in V Series (V35, V36, V37 & Infiniti)
My Kinteix hfcs come down from the engine at a more extreme angle (to give them clearance from the car body), so the rear of the Y-pipe sits much lower than oem and is literally 5cm off the ground. I scrape the join on EVERY speed hump I go over. Then I put on a custom made 3" mid pipe that was way too loud, so put a resonator on it, then that hit everything as well - ended up tearing open the rear of the resonator when the car bottomed out on a bumpy road at 110km/h. So I had to put the oem one back on - it is actually almost triangular-shaped so the bottom of it doesn't hit the ground over bumps! I used to sit 1 inch lower, but have raised the car up due to physically getting the car STUCK on things! One tim eI had to get 3 nearby guys to hold the rear of the car down so the wheels touched the ground so I could power off a footpath/driveway join! So now the gap between my tyres and guards is nearly 5cm and I STILL scrape on everything (I do have a lower aftermarket front bar admittedly). -
